Challenges Faced by New Mineral Water Plant Entrepreneurs
While the commercial opportunity is clear, the pathway to establishing a compliant, commercially viable mineral water plant is far from straightforward. First-time entrants consistently encounter a cluster of interconnected challenges that can derail even well-funded projects if not managed by experienced partners.
Technology Selection and Configuration
New entrepreneurs frequently struggle to identify the right combination of purification technologies — reverse osmosis, UV treatment, ozonation, remineralization — for their specific source water chemistry and output requirements. A mismatch at this stage leads to recurring quality failures, regulatory non-compliance, and expensive mid-project redesigns.
Regulatory and Quality Certification Complexity
Obtaining BIS certification in India, meeting export quality standards for international markets, and navigating state-level licensing requirements demands detailed knowledge of applicable standards. Most new entrepreneurs lack both the technical understanding and the institutional connections to navigate this efficiently. Delays in certification directly translate into delayed revenue generation.
Vendor Credibility and After-Sales Support
The market for water treatment equipment is fragmented, and the risk of engaging suppliers who lack technical depth or post-installation service capabilities is very real. Equipment breakdowns during production, lack of spare parts availability, and inadequate operator training can paralyse a newly commissioned plant, causing significant financial and reputational damage.
Brand Building and Market Entry
Beyond the plant itself, entrepreneurs must build a brand that earns consumer trust in a market dominated by established names. Packaging design, label compliance, distribution channel development, and promotional strategy require guidance that most pure-play equipment suppliers are unable to offer.
Capital Allocation and Return on Investment Planning
Without accurate feasibility modelling, entrepreneurs often either over-invest in capacity that cannot be utilised in the short term or under-invest in quality controls that prove costly later. A trusted advisor who can model realistic cash flows and ROI trajectories is invaluable at the project conception stage.
